Tar and gravel roof repair services address common issues such as leaks, cracks, and surface deterioration on built-up roofing systems. These roofs, often found on commercial and some residential buildings, consist of multiple layers of asphalt and gravel, providing durability and weather resistance. Projects typically involve patching damaged areas, replacing worn-out gravel, sealing seams, and addressing underlying structural concerns to restore the roof’s integrity and extend its lifespan. Common Tar And Gravel Roof Repair Jobs
Tar and Gravel Roof Repair - addresses leaks and damage to existing tar and gravel roofing systems.
Patch and Seal - involves applying patches and sealants to small cracks and holes.
Roof Coating - adds a protective layer to extend the lifespan of the roof surface.
Gravel Replacement - replaces or adds gravel to maintain proper roof weight and protection.
Leak Detection - identifies the source of leaks to prevent further water damage.
Complete Overhaul - involves removing and replacing the entire roofing system when needed.
Tar And Gravel Roof Repair Questions
What issues indicate a need for tar and gravel roof repair? Signs include pooling water, cracked or blistered surface, and missing gravel patches that can lead to leaks and further damage.
How are repairs typically performed on tar and gravel roofs? Repairs involve removing damaged sections, applying new bitumen membrane, and restoring gravel to ensure a watertight seal.
Can small damages be fixed without replacing the entire roof? Yes, localized repairs can address cracks, blisters, or punctures without the need for full roof replacement.
What maintenance helps extend the life of a tar and gravel roof? Regular inspections, removing debris, and addressing minor damages promptly can help prolong roof performance.
